((a/the)) windsock a cloth tube that shows wind direction The windsock at the airfield showed a strong crosswind.

Synonyms: wind cone

From 'wind' + 'sock'. It's shaped like a large sock that catches the wind.

Imagine a huge 'sock' flying on a pole, catching the 'wind' to tell pilots which way it's blowing.
